Cozy Mystery CPAs and Cozy Mystery Financial Advisors…Who'd 'a Thunk It?

For those of you cozy mystery readers who enjoy "money matters"… the following three authors should be of interest to you. These mystery authors have chosen to give their main characters professions that you wouldn't ordinarily associate with a cozy mystery sleuth…

Connie Shelton  writes the Charlie Parker Mystery Series which is based in New Mexico, and features an accountant….

Patricia Smiley's Tucker Sinclair Mystery Series features a financial management/advisor

Jennifer Sturman's Rachel Benjamin's Mystery Series has an investment banker as her sleuth.  (By the way, Jennifer Sturman's fourth novel in the Rachel Benjamin Mystery Series…. The Hunt, is being released this month!)

It's time for us (the cozy mystery readers) to get rid of our notions of knitting needles, mustache combs, and walking canes in lieu of calculators, pie charts, and index graphics!
